黑狐家游戏

中小学网站源码开发,构建智慧教育生态的技术实践与案例分析,小学版网址

欧气 1 0

【技术架构创新】 现代中小学网站源码开发已突破传统静态页面模式,形成包含前端框架、后端服务、数据中台的三层架构体系,前端采用Vue3+TypeScript构建响应式界面,支持PC/平板/手机多端适配,通过WebSocket实现实时消息推送,后端基于Spring Cloud微服务架构,将用户认证、课程管理、作业系统等模块解耦为独立服务,采用JWT令牌实现跨域安全通信,数据库层面运用MySQL集群配合Redis缓存,通过分库分表技术支撑日均10万级并发访问,特别在资源管理模块,采用Elasticsearch实现百万级课件文件的秒级检索,构建教育资源的智能分发体系。

【核心功能模块解构】

  1. 教学管理系统:开发基于RBAC模型的权限控制系统,支持5级角色权限配置(校长-教研组-教师-学生-家长),作业批改模块集成OCR识别技术,实现手写体作业自动批改,准确率达92%,在线考试系统采用防作弊算法,通过屏幕监控、行为分析、环境检测三重防护机制。

    中小学网站源码开发,构建智慧教育生态的技术实践与案例分析,小学版网址

    图片来源于网络,如有侵权联系删除

  2. 资源共建平台:构建教育资源区块链存证系统,采用Hyperledger Fabric框架实现课件版权的分布式存证,开发智能推荐引擎,基于学生学情数据(错题率、知识点掌握度)和LDA主题模型,实现个性化资源推送,建立教育资源众包机制,开发教师协作编辑器支持多人在线协作,版本控制精度达毫秒级。

  3. 互动社区系统:运用WebSocket+WebSocket-Server构建实时通讯系统,支持课堂互动、在线答疑、学习小组等场景,开发教育版Discord系统,集成AI助教模块,能自动识别学生聊天内容并生成知识点解析,家长端开发智能画像系统,通过学习数据可视化仪表盘呈现学生成长轨迹。

【开发流程标准化】 建立CMMI 3级认证的开发流程:需求阶段采用用户旅程地图(User Journey Map)进行场景化需求分析,绘制包含200+关键节点的业务流程图,设计阶段运用UML建模工具构建时序图、类图等模型,通过Axure制作高保真原型,开发阶段实施Git Flow分支管理,建立SonarQube代码质量门禁(SonarQube检测规则达500+条),测试阶段采用JMeter+Postman+Appium构建全链路测试矩阵,压力测试要求达到TPS≥500,部署阶段实施Kubernetes容器化部署,通过Prometheus+Grafana构建监控大屏,实现99.99%可用性保障。

【安全防护体系构建】 开发多层安全防护机制:传输层采用TLS 1.3协议加密,会话层实施HMAC-Sha256签名验证,数据层开发动态脱敏算法,对学籍号、家庭住址等敏感信息进行智能替换,权限系统采用ABAC动态访问控制模型,结合地理围栏技术限制校外访问,开发自动化安全扫描系统,集成OWASP ZAP、Nessus等工具,实现每周漏洞扫描,特别针对未成年人保护,建立内容安全过滤系统,集成阿里云内容安全API,对200+敏感词库进行实时监测。

【典型案例深度剖析】

  1. 某农村中学智慧校园项目:基于Django+MySQL+Docker构建轻量化平台,开发离线资源下载系统,支持4G网络环境下断点续传,定制农校特色模块,集成农业实践课程管理、家校共育种植日志等功能,通过CDN加速技术将资源加载速度提升至1.2秒以内,获评教育部信息化示范项目。

    中小学网站源码开发,构建智慧教育生态的技术实践与案例分析,小学版网址

    图片来源于网络,如有侵权联系删除

  2. 城市重点中学AI实验室项目:开发深度学习教学平台,集成TensorFlow.js实现AI模型可视化训练,构建虚拟实验室系统,采用WebGL技术3D还原物理化学实验场景,开发AR教学助手,通过ARKit实现化学分子结构动态展示,建立数据中台,日均处理教学行为数据50万条,生成个性化学习报告准确率达89%。

【技术演进趋势】 当前源码开发呈现三大趋势:微前端架构普及率达73%(2023年教育信息化白皮书数据),TypeScript使用率从2019年的18%跃升至2023年的61%,教育专有名词智能检索准确率提升至95%,知识图谱构建效率提高40%,开发工具链集成度增强,Jenkins+GitLab CI/CD构建周期缩短至15分钟,未来将向边缘计算发展,计划在校园部署5G MEC节点,实现教学数据本地化处理,延迟控制在10ms以内。

【开源生态建设】 发起"教育开源联盟"项目,已积累120万行高质量代码,形成包含认证系统、资源平台、数据分析等6大核心模块的开源组件库,建立开发者社区,累计解决技术问题3800+,贡献代码1.2万次,开发文档采用Swagger+Swagger UI实现交互式API文档,构建包含200+教学场景的示例代码库,通过Gitee开源平台获得教育机构认可,已有327所学校采用联盟代码库,平均节省开发成本45%。

本源码体系已通过等保三级认证,获得国家版权局软件著作权2项,在2023年全国教育信息化创新大赛中斩获一等奖,技术团队持续迭代开发,计划2024年Q2上线智能预警系统,通过机器学习预测学生辍学风险,准确率达81%,通过持续的技术创新与生态建设,为构建高质量教育体系提供坚实技术支撑。

(全文共计1287字,技术细节更新至2023年12月数据)

标签: #中小学网站源码

黑狐家游戏
  • 评论列表

留言评论